All markings and signages should be visible and prominent by day or by night. They are useful not only for handicapped persons, but also for able-bodied persons so that they do not inadvertently occupy or use the facilities reserved for the handicapped. For instance, it is important to mark reserved parking areas prominently on the floor surface in addition to clearly visible sign posts, so that no valid person parks his vehicle inadvertently in the reserved area.
